SINGAPORE - Speaker of Parliament Tan Chuan-Jin and former minister for national development Mah Bow Tan may be best known as politicians, but they also happen to be keen lensmen.
Mr Tan, 53, became interested in photography when he was with the Singapore Armed Forces. Drawn to the nature around him while training outdoors, he wanted to capture these sights through his lens.
